Bone scan findings in hypervitaminosis D: case report.

I Fogelman, J H McKillop, E A Cowden

    Journal of Nuclear Medicine : Official Publication, Society of Nuclear Medicine
    |December 1, 1977
    PubMed
    Summary

    Generalized increased bone scan uptake and faint kidney images in three patients suggest potential vitamin D toxicity. Other causes like renal osteodystrophy were also considered.

    Area of Science:

    • Nuclear medicine
    • Radiopharmacology
    • Nephrology

    Background:

    • Bone scans are crucial diagnostic tools in nuclear medicine.
    • Assessing skeletal and renal function is vital for patient management.
    • Vitamin D's role in calcium homeostasis and bone health is well-established.

    Observation:

    • Three patients presented with generalized symmetrical increased radiopharmaceutical uptake in bone scans.
    • Kidney visualization on bone scans was absent or faint in these patients.

    Findings:

    • The observed bone scan patterns suggest potential vitamin D toxicity.
    • Differential diagnoses, including renal osteodystrophy, were explored to explain the findings.

    Implications:
